Lakshminarasimhan Srinivasan is a pioneering researcher in telerobotics and human-robot interaction, with a focus on enabling reliable remote control of robots over variable and constrained networks. His major contributions center on the innovative use of WebSockets as a low-latency, full-duplex communication protocol for teleoperation—a concept he advanced in his most-cited work, *"Analysis of WebSockets as the New Age Protocol for Remote Robot Tele-operation"* (19 citations). He further developed this into a duplex WebSocket system for variable bandwidth environments, and explored augmented reality navigation to mitigate time delays in teleoperation. Srinivasan also addressed the underexplored challenge of multi-user control of a single robot through an adaptive, intelligent voting framework. Beyond technical design, he recognized the educational potential of telerobotics, proposing a pedagogical and technology management framework for its use in classrooms. His work on IoT-based multi-sensor surveillance robots also demonstrates a practical application of his research. With a career spanning foundational protocol design to adaptive multi-agent control, Srinivasan’s research has laid important groundwork for robust, scalable, and educational teleoperation systems.
